Garlic Parmesan Chicken Soup Recipe
A comforting and creamy Garlic Parmesan Chicken Soup featuring tender chicken, sautéed vegetables, and a rich Parmesan-infused broth with pasta. This hearty soup combines savory garlic, Italian seasoning, and fresh parsley to create a delicious one-pot meal perfect for any day.

Sauté Base
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, peeled and chopped
- 6 cloves garlic, minced
Main Ingredients
- 1 pound chicken breasts or thighs
- 6 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- 1 cup short pasta (ditalini or small shells)
Finishing Ingredients
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up freshly grated parmesan cheese
- Salt to taste
- Black p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
- Sauté Vegetables: Heat olive oil and butter in a large pot over medium heat. Add chopped onions, carrots, and a pinch of salt. Sauté until the vegetables are softened, about 5-7 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Add Chicken and Broth: Place the chicken breasts or thighs into the pot. Pour in the low-sodium chicken broth and add Italian seasoning.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and let it simmer for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Shred Chicken: Remove the chicken pieces from the pot and shred them using two forks. Return the shredded chicken back into the pot.
- Cook Pasta: Add your choice of short pasta (ditalini or small shells) to the simmering soup. Cook until the pasta is al dente, stirring occasionally to prevent it from sticking, usually about 8-10 minutes depending on pasta type.
- Add Cream and Parmesan: Turn off the heat and allow the soup to cool slightly for 2-3 minutes. Slowly stir in the heavy cream. Gradually add the freshly grated Parmesan cheese a handful at a time, stirring continuously until it fully melts into the soup, creating a creamy texture.
- Season and Garnish: Stir in chopped fresh parsley. Taste and adjust the seasoning with salt and black pepper as desired. Serve hot with extra Parmesan cheese sprinkled on top if preferred.
Notes
- Use low-sodium chicken broth to better control the salt content in the soup.
- Any short pasta like orzo or small elbow macaroni can be substituted if ditalini or small shells are not available.
- For a lighter version, you can substitute half-and-half in place of heavy cream.
- Leftover soup keeps well refrigerated for up to 3 days and also freezes well.
- Shredding the chicken ensures tender bites and evenly distributed protein throughout the soup.
